“Digital first” isn’t a buzzword in financial services any more — it’s reality. Digital accelerated to the forefront amid the COVID-19 pandemic, but it’s become clear as governments lift stay-at-home orders that it’s now many consumers’ preferred way of getting things done. Credit unions have long prided themselves on offering better in-person service, but with lockdowns keeping members from branches, many CUs worry about losing customers to challenger banks with better digital offerings, says Doug Marshall, chief digital and product officer at Washington-based BECU.
